Keanu Reeves Biography
Keanu Charles Reeves was born on September 2, 1964, in Beirut, Lebanon. His father, Samuel Nowlin Reeves Jr., was an American of English, Hawaiian, and Chinese descent. His mother, Patricia Bond, was an English costume designer and showgirl who had moved to Beirut before Keanu was born.
His name “Keanu” means “cool breeze over the mountains” in Hawaiian — a fitting name for someone who has always carried himself with striking calm.
A Childhood Across Four Countries
Keanu’s early life was defined by constant movement and family upheaval. When he was just three years old, his father abandoned the family and was later convicted of drug possession. Keanu’s mother then moved the family — first to Sydney, Australia, then to New York City, and finally settling in Toronto, Canada, where Keanu spent most of his teenage years.
Growing up, Keanu attended four different high schools in Toronto. He struggled academically due to dyslexia, which made reading and writing genuinely difficult. Despite this, he found his footing in two unexpected places: ice hockey (he was a talented goalie known as “The Wall”) and acting.
He studied at the Avondale Secondary Alternative School in Toronto and trained at the Second City Theatre. He dropped out of high school before graduating to pursue acting full-time — a gamble that clearly paid off.

Keanu Reeves Career Timeline
Keanu Reeves’ career spans four decades and covers everything from teen comedies to profound science fiction to relentless action thrillers. His journey from Canadian stage actor to global superstar is one of Hollywood’s great stories.
1984–88
Early Career — TV & Stage
Keanu began acting in Toronto theatre and Canadian TV shows. His first notable role came in Youngblood (1986), a hockey film that drew on his real-life skills as a goalie.
1989
Breakthrough — Bill & Ted’s Excellent Adventure
The time-travel comedy made Reeves a recognizable face and proved he had genuine comedic timing. It launched a franchise that continued into the 2020s with Bill & Ted Face the Music.
1991
Point Break — Action Credibility
Playing undercover FBI agent Johnny Utah opposite Patrick Swayze, Reeves earned his action star credentials and demonstrated real range beyond comedy.
1994
Speed — A-List Arrival
Opposite Sandra Bullock, Speed turned Reeves into a true Hollywood A-lister. The film grossed $350 million worldwide on a $30M budget. He famously turned down Speed 2 to star in a stage production of Hamlet in Canada.
1999–2003
The Matrix Trilogy — Global Icon
Playing Neo in the Wachowski sisters’ sci-fi masterpiece changed everything. All three Matrix films combined earned over $1.6 billion at the worldwide box office. Reeves reportedly earned $35–40 million per film, plus backend profit-sharing that pushed his Matrix earnings past $250 million.
2014–2023
John Wick Era — A Second Prime
At 50 years old, Reeves launched a second blockbuster franchise that many actors in their 30s couldn’t sustain. The four main John Wick films earned a combined $1.1 billion globally. He earned $20–25 million per installment, with franchise spin-offs and sequels still in production.
2021–2026
Matrix Resurrections, BRZRKR & Ongoing Projects
Beyond acting, Reeves co-wrote the bestselling comic book BRZRKR, which has been optioned for a Netflix animated series and live-action film — projects that will add substantially to his net worth in coming years.

Arch Motorcycle Company
In 2011, Keanu Reeves co-founded Arch Motorcycle Company with master builder Gard Hallinger. What started as a personal project — building a custom motorcycle for himself — evolved into a boutique luxury motorcycle brand.
Each Arch motorcycle is handbuilt in Los Angeles and priced between $78,000 and $120,000. The company produces a small number of bikes each year, targeting the ultra-premium market. Revenue is estimated at $1–2 million annually, with Reeves’ ownership stake making it a meaningful long-term asset as the brand grows.

Alexandra Grant — His Current Partner
Since 2019, Keanu Reeves has been in a relationship with Alexandra Grant, a Los Angeles-based visual artist known for her text-based artwork. The two first collaborated professionally on a 2011 book of philosophical prose poems written by Reeves, illustrated by Grant.
They went public as a couple at the LACMA Art + Film Gala in November 2019, and the internet celebrated the moment enthusiastically. Grant is also co-founder of the GrantLove Project, a nonprofit that supports artists. In 2020, Reeves and Grant co-founded X Artists’ Books, an independent publishing house, deepening their creative and professional partnership.

Family Background
Keanu’s mother, Patricia Bond, was a hugely positive influence in his life. A costume designer who worked with artists including Alice Cooper, she raised Keanu largely alone after his father’s departure. Despite moving the family across multiple countries, she gave Keanu exposure to creative industries from an early age.
His father, Samuel Nowlin Reeves Jr., abandoned the family when Keanu was three and was arrested multiple times on drug charges. Keanu has said in interviews that he met his father only a handful of times and that they were never close.
Keanu has a half-sister, Karina Miller, through his mother, and a sister named Kim Reeves, who battled leukemia for years. Keanu quietly funded much of Kim’s medical treatment and donated substantially to leukemia research — something he kept private for years.

Music Career — Dogstar
Few people know that Keanu Reeves is also a musician. In the early 1990s, he co-founded Dogstar, a rock band in which he played bass guitar. The band toured extensively through the mid-to-late 1990s, including as an opening act for David Bowie, Bon Jovi, and Weezer.
Dogstar released two studio albums — Quattro Formaggi (1996) and Happy Ending (2000). The band broke up in the early 2000s but reformed in 2023, releasing new music and touring again. For Reeves, Dogstar was never about money — it was genuinely about his love for music and collaboration.
